diff options
author | V3n3RiX <venerix@koprulu.sector> | 2023-04-14 05:44:50 +0100 |
---|---|---|
committer | V3n3RiX <venerix@koprulu.sector> | 2023-04-14 05:44:50 +0100 |
commit | 1d18b53ed419c49eb3f71637ccd58a431c1368d4 (patch) | |
tree | eb3671b1209855aa64534ee96262d06bcda99d74 /dev-cpp/edencommon | |
parent | fdca6388cf31827202fae75cae067c695bd09339 (diff) |
gentoo auto-resync : 14:04:2023 - 05:44:49
Diffstat (limited to 'dev-cpp/edencommon')
-rw-r--r-- | dev-cpp/edencommon/Manifest | 2 | ||||
-rw-r--r-- | dev-cpp/edencommon/edencommon-2023.04.10.00.ebuild | 41 |
2 files changed, 43 insertions, 0 deletions
diff --git a/dev-cpp/edencommon/Manifest b/dev-cpp/edencommon/Manifest index db3957a20150..092cf8f4a31a 100644 --- a/dev-cpp/edencommon/Manifest +++ b/dev-cpp/edencommon/Manifest @@ -1,5 +1,7 @@ DIST edencommon-2022.08.29.00.gh.tar.gz 143430 BLAKE2B a66bae35413097140b24c9313b12d55d52cbd98396ff1afacc751eb9752d4116ab19aeb9320dead5500189d74b4d91fdc09d9648fc6b5fbb55a706328488e7ef SHA512 6622c5de2dbff96717a345c82aaf9335745ed57262bb55c7a6704a68259ce81376ff0a2e9f3818ed1c1f08434da704f31fd4e3d8c48dd13646f0202e7564b2c7 DIST edencommon-2023.02.06.00.gh.tar.gz 144809 BLAKE2B bfde04282eff3ad745ed02708ba550e81c3d7916c634f01bc3fa9f2232953b4ccc8f319378636add4122cdf4c944212d7ecb649072c82f44dd8751640bc8f260 SHA512 c5763aa6a035febc6ce2a8b32c7ffb576b0a73448cf44e4a3788d87c45507a429065a02c37bce2165b2b51b3139cef51dc5ecd6cce203093f9043387b8912b15 +DIST edencommon-2023.04.10.00.gh.tar.gz 146594 BLAKE2B 8712de4a79d1f0d2fc2f9fb88c6ea262e5b9c849c96848a3ff0906085e0088a3d68efe12b7e4d7085c05f6909f06da5f3b40c54af522da21bd19a0b795aef06f SHA512 2f1c32b1940834f0b6e5cd104832f0a373cb417fd3e64e9e744c95b24361a3df5e540bf14a74be15a95b4c241cfec92c6185bc0bf11e1de927f729a3a9458ee8 EBUILD edencommon-2022.08.29.00.ebuild 869 BLAKE2B 55f75751770a07d0201ff07640ebda0fd724541acdd174976577e16dabf95582f346491fa713ac7d2af12d465884ef69dd3e44799b6f772847dbf8942def247a SHA512 775e7af49b381efb4062c02cc407b6dbbbada6ba5428e7cf96f6264a2240876fef841099320d5335c445ac0e3cd3f06056c23e1ca94f2c066efea5cb8a7cc472 EBUILD edencommon-2023.02.06.00.ebuild 875 BLAKE2B 9923ebe3369d37693f295570084ea079de3116099b9ed507ccda4279da5e64fcecaddaa2b3e5d710eb9d066e62a96e3308f2da3dfaaa42f7b1f0e9df73cc0d93 SHA512 e9e9cb9c0ec650a3599ade17a854faf679f67c2277beaafacd1f38f9db97bc032bb74b502acf87b32e2c81fb13f60a79036e28682d976250c9c309eb136cacbd +EBUILD edencommon-2023.04.10.00.ebuild 875 BLAKE2B 9923ebe3369d37693f295570084ea079de3116099b9ed507ccda4279da5e64fcecaddaa2b3e5d710eb9d066e62a96e3308f2da3dfaaa42f7b1f0e9df73cc0d93 SHA512 e9e9cb9c0ec650a3599ade17a854faf679f67c2277beaafacd1f38f9db97bc032bb74b502acf87b32e2c81fb13f60a79036e28682d976250c9c309eb136cacbd MISC metadata.xml 336 BLAKE2B d87d655ad085e53410760329202ce130e41d98fd35ca8c9e38c07665177a21d187c94a4570d3c18a409eeb89f00017edd50cd127adbbd35f99a0da1fd342f048 SHA512 894ed9ebd715743d2ce4591456a5776e1e215cf8845ffa0e16e6b6a25b316213b5547b0e3717050dc83518c9c2e100348c0804f25e599cb785415b8411def8ac diff --git a/dev-cpp/edencommon/edencommon-2023.04.10.00.ebuild b/dev-cpp/edencommon/edencommon-2023.04.10.00.ebuild new file mode 100644 index 000000000000..411e811b2905 --- /dev/null +++ b/dev-cpp/edencommon/edencommon-2023.04.10.00.ebuild @@ -0,0 +1,41 @@ +# Copyright 2022-2023 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+# These must be bumped together: +# dev-cpp/edencommon +# dev-cpp/folly +# dev-util/watchman + +inherit cmake + +DESCRIPTION="Shared library for Watchman and Eden projects" +HOMEPAGE="https://github.com/facebookexperimental/edencommon" +SRC_URI="https://github.com/facebookexperimental/edencommon/archive/refs/tags/v${PV}.tar.gz -> ${P}.gh.tar.gz" + +LICENSE="MIT" +SLOT="0/${PV}" +KEYWORDS="~amd64" +IUSE="llvm-libunwind" + +RDEPEND=" + dev-cpp/gflags:= + dev-cpp/glog:=[gflags] + dev-cpp/folly:= + llvm-libunwind? ( sys-libs/llvm-libunwind:= ) + !llvm-libunwind? ( sys-libs/libunwind:= ) +" +DEPEND=" + ${RDEPEND} + dev-cpp/gtest +" + +src_configure() { + local mycmakeargs=( + -DCMAKE_INSTALL_DIR="$(get_libdir)/cmake/${PN}" + -DLIB_INSTALL_DIR="$(get_libdir)" + ) + + cmake_src_configure +} |